Blue Julius return, sooner than hoped, with songwriting superiority and faultless production, shining light upon a song that inherently seeks to do the same within a darkened world.
Promising a crisp acoustic guitar groove, live drums, and female vocals gorgeously harmonised, I Want The World achieves a style and tone somewhere between the likes of Jewel and Morcheeba – a breathy poetic lead, a hypnotic acoustic groove, and a level of conviction and relevance that’s subtly woven into an uplifting, colourful, creative embrace.
Inspired by the selfless journey of someone who has been hurt, had their heartbroken, but still feels a sense of possibility and hope – allowing any feelings of regret or anger to fall away – I Want The World celebrates the essential act of letting go; moving on from heartbreak and toxicity, and believing you’re worthy of better.
This inspiring and reflective ode to a better personal world is refreshing, and Blue Julius more than deliver on the musical vibes required to let that euphoric idea of self-love really take hold. The final fifth presents a psychedelic alt-folk instrumental outro that’s suddenly energised and awakening, and this follows the softness and intimacy of the song quite beautifully.
The band’s new vocalist brings something exciting and special to the set-up, and I Want The World is an outstanding opening take, from an act whose authenticity and talent consistently intertwine humanity, harmony, and heart.
